Map Of Massachusetts. Carleton, Osgood, 1801
![]() View larger, zoomable image (turn off pop-up blocker) Full Title: Map Of Massachusetts Proper Compiled from Actual Surveys, made by Order of the General Court, and under the inspection of Agents of their appointment, By Osgood Carleton. Engraved by Joseph Callender and Samuel Hill, Boston, 1801. Vignette Drawn by G. Graham. Full David Rumsey Map Collection Catalog Record: Author: Carleton, Osgood Date: 1801 Short Title: Map Of Massachusetts. Publisher: Boston: Osgood Carleton Type: Case Map Object Height cm: 81 Object Width cm: 119 Scale 1: 253,440 Note: Engraved by Joseph Callender and Samuel Hill. Second map of Massachusetts by Carleton (1st was 1798), reengraved from the plates of the first issue, and the first official state map (the first edition was rejected by the legislature). With outline and full color. Map is dissected into 32 sections and mounted on linen. Folds into original black cardboard slip case 21x16 with a red leather label on the spine reading "Map Of Mass." in gilt. Reference: Phillips Maps p400; Ristow p92.
